Superiority

zeolite 13x

molecular sieve 13x is a multiple purpose, highly porous, high capacity alkali metal alumino-silicate in the spherical form. it is the sodium form of the type x crystal structure with pore diameters of approximately 10å. it can adsorb all molecules that can be adsorbed by 3a, 4a, and 5a molecular sieve. type 13x molecular sieve can also adsorb molecules such as aromatics and branched-chain hydrocarbons, which have large critical diameters.
